Debra Jenkins, Founder

Debra Jenkins, winner of the prestigious Virginia Hammill Simms Award for outstanding contribution to the arts, has been on the faculty of such institutions as the Montgomery Civic Ballet, The Birmingham Ballet Company and Huntsville Community Ballet. She has worked as a volunteer in many capacities for most of Huntsville's premiere arts organizations, including serving as Chairman of Panoply 1997. She was the first Director of Public Relations for The Arts Council, Inc. of Huntsville. Until 2012, Debra served as Merrimack Hall's volunteer Executive Director. Today, she serves as Chairman of the organization's advisory board, and continually works to grow Merrimack Hall's Johnny Stallings Arts Program.

Ashley Dinges, Executive Director

Ashley Dinges is a Huntsville transplant from San Jose, California, where she worked at the San Jose Mercury News newspaper. Previously, she worked at publications including the Detroit Free Press and The Detroit News. Her design, writing and editing work has been honored by organizations including the Society for News Design and the American Advertising Federation. She received her undergraduate degree from the University of Michigan, and recently completed Columbia Business School's Developing Leaders Program for Nonprofit Professionals. She is a proud graduate of Leadership Huntsville's Connect Class 14, and serves on the boards of the Downtown Forty-Seven, Causeway Huntsville, and the Association of Fundraising Professionals North Alabama Chapter. Kristen Wilson, Development Associate

Kristen Wilson recently moved back to Huntsville, AL after spending almost ten years in Philadelphia. While there she danced with the world renowned modern dance company, PHILADANCO! and co-directed and co-founded a pre-professional dance company, EPHOD. With roots deep in music, singing, theater, and dancing, she also has a passion for non-profit management and grant-writing. She has served as the Development Director for both the Main Line YMCA and PHILADANCO! and was an Advanced Program Director for the Columbia North YMCA and most recently the Director of Administration for the Love Kingdom Fellowship Church in Philadelphia. She attended the University of Alabama with a theater scholarship, has a bachelor’s degree in Marketing from AIU and a Certificate in Faith and Spirituality in Behavioral Health Counseling from the Community College of Philadelphia.
